-- module: quick note taking/searching
-- (Inspired by Notational Velocity, by Zachary Schneirov)
--
-- Can pass in a directory, so it's easy to bind different keys to different
-- directories of files. (I use a general "notes" as well as "til" for
-- today-I-learned technical notes).
local m = {}
local ufile = require('utils.file')
local ustring = require('utils.string')
local lastApp = nil
local chooser = nil
local matchCache = {}
local rankCache = {}
local allChoices = nil
local currentPath = nil
local lastQueries = {}
local visible = false
-- COMMANDS
local commands = {
{
['text'] = 'Create...',
['subText'] = 'Create a new note with the query as filename',
['command'] = 'create',
}
}
-- command filters can't be placed in the command table above because chooser
-- choice tables must be serializable, so we create a separate table for them.
local commandFilters = {
['create'] = function()
local filePath = ufile.toPath(currentPath, chooser:query())
return not ufile.exists(ufile.withExtension(filePath, 'md'))
end,
}
--------------------
-- sort by rank and then by alphabet
local function choiceSort(a, b)
if a.rank == b.rank then return a.text < b.text end
return a.rank > b.rank
end
-- retrieve the last query string that was used in the chooser
local function getLastQuery()
return lastQueries[currentPath] or ''
end
-- get a sorted table of all available choices for the current path
local function getAllChoices()
local iterFn, dirObj = hs.fs.dir(currentPath)
local item = iterFn(dirObj)
local choices = {}
while item do
local filePath = ufile.toPath(currentPath, item)
-- we only care about markdown files (*.md)
if string.find(item, '^[^%.].-%.md') then
local paragraph = {}
-- read the file to provide additional text for searching
-- as well as a bit of subtext in the chooser item.
local f = io.open(filePath)
local line = f:read()
while line ~= nil do
if string.len(line) > 0 then
paragraph[#paragraph+1] = line
end
line = f:read()
end
f:close()
local contents = table.concat(paragraph, '\n')
choices[#choices+1] = {
['text'] = item,
['additionalSearchText'] = contents,
['subText'] = paragraph[1],
['rank'] = 0,
['path'] = filePath,
}
end
item = iterFn(dirObj)
end
table.sort(choices, choiceSort)
return choices
end
-- refocus on the app that was focused before the chooser was invoked
local function refocus()
if lastApp ~= nil then
lastApp:activate()
lastApp = nil
end
end
-- open the given file in the default OS X text editor for .md files
-- (You can change this in OS X by selecting a .md file, hitting cmd-i, finding
-- the "open with" panel, changing the app to whatever app you want, and then
-- hitting the "Change all" button.)
local function launchEditor(path)
path = ufile.withExtension(path, 'md')
if not ufile.exists(path) then
ufile.create(path)
end
local task = hs.task.new('/usr/bin/open', nil, {'-t', path})
task:start()
end
-- callback when a choice is made from the chooser
local function choiceCallback(choice)
local query = chooser:query()
local path
refocus()
visible = false
lastQueries[currentPath] = query
-- create a new file and open it, if the create command was chosen, otherwise
-- open the chosen filename.
if choice.command == 'create' then
path = ufile.toPath(currentPath, query)
else
path = choice.path
end
if path ~= nil then
launchEditor(path)
end
end
-- determine the rank for a given file based on the search query string. this
-- gives more weight to filenames (a.k.a. titles) that match the query
-- directly, than content text that matches, specified by
-- config.notational.titleWeight. Results are cached while typing, to speed
-- things up a bit (but the cache is emptied when the chooser is hidden).
local function getRank(queries, choice)
local rank = 0
local choiceText = choice.text:lower()
for _, q in ipairs(queries) do
local qq = q:lower()
local cacheKey = qq .. '|' .. choiceText
if rankCache[cacheKey] == nil then
local _, count1 = string.gsub(choiceText, qq, qq)
local _, count2 = string.gsub(choice.additionalSearchText:lower(), qq, qq)
-- title match is much more likely to be relevant
rankCache[cacheKey] = count1 * m.cfg.titleWeight + count2
end
-- If any single query term doesn't match then we don't match at all
if rankCache[cacheKey] == 0 then return 0 end
rank = rank + rankCache[cacheKey]
end
return rank
end
-- callback while the user is typing in the chooser window. This determines
-- which files to show in the chooser list by ranking files that match the
-- query string. The "Create" command is always shown at the bottom. Matches
-- are cached while typing to speed things up a little, but the cache is
-- emptied when the chooser window is hidden.
local function queryChangedCallback(query)
if query == '' then
chooser:choices(allChoices)
else
local choices = {}
if matchCache[query] == nil then
local queries = ustring.split(query, ' ')
for _, aChoice in ipairs(allChoices) do
aChoice.rank = getRank(queries, aChoice)
if aChoice.rank > 0 then
choices[#choices+1] = aChoice
end
end
table.sort(choices, choiceSort)
-- add commands last, after sorting
for _, aCommand in ipairs(commands) do
local filter = commandFilters[aCommand.command]
if filter ~= nil and filter() then
choices[#choices+1] = aCommand
end
end
matchCache[query] = choices
end
chooser:choices(matchCache[query])
end
end
-- toggle the chooser window for the given path
function m.toggle(path)
if chooser ~= nil then
if visible then
m.hide()
else
m.show(path)
end
end
end
-- show the chooser window for the given path
function m.show(path)
if chooser ~= nil then
lastApp = hs.application.frontmostApplication()
matchCache = {}
rankCache = {}
currentPath = path or m.cfg.path.notes
chooser:query(getLastQuery())
allChoices = getAllChoices()
chooser:show()
visible = true
end
end
-- hide the chooser window
function m.hide()
if chooser ~= nil then
-- hide calls choiceCallback
chooser:hide()
end
end
function m.start()
chooser = hs.chooser.new(choiceCallback)
chooser:width(m.cfg.width)
chooser:rows(m.cfg.rows)
chooser:queryChangedCallback(queryChangedCallback)
chooser:choices(allChoices)
currentPath = m.cfg.path.notes
end
function m.stop()
if chooser then chooser:delete() end
chooser = nil
lastApp = nil
matchCache = nil
rankCache = nil
allChoices = nil
lastQueries = nil
commands = nil
currentPath = nil
end
return m
